Google Talk Gadget enables Google Talk from web pages

Google has released a new Google Gadget which enables a web user to embed the company’s instant-messaging service in Web pages.

This would further expand the availability of the service which initially began as a software download and was later integrated with Google’s Gmail service.

This gadget loads a flash powered interface on Web pages which would enable web users to communicate with each other using text messages.

Google trails other instant message service providers in the market including AOL, Microsoft and Yahoo! With these new initiatives, they expect to expand the popularity of their Google Talk service.
